If i was to take a clear blue pregnancy test 1 week after i conseved, how accurate would it be?

Would it be to early to take it ?


How long would i have to wait ?If i was to take a clear blue pregnancy test 1 week after i conseved, how accurate would it be?

not accurate at all the earliest you can test is 5 days before your expected period and even then the chances of getting a false negative are pretty hight. You best to wait untill the day of your expected period. Most women do not have enough HcG in their systems untill then for the test to read it.
It all depends on when implantation takes place (takes between 6-12 days) so it varies. Your best bet would be to wait and see if you skip. You can take it if you really want to but if it's negative then you may want to wait and see if you skip before you test again
wait till missed period for most accurate results... 5 days after wouldnt be accurate at all... the instructions in the test tell you how accurate it can be so many days before your missed period.
